LP Candidate Vows To Defeat APC In Edo Central By-election

The candidate of the Labour Party for Edo Central Senatorial District in next month’s by-election, Hon Paul Okojie, has vowed to defeat the All Progressives Congress (APC), Joe Okojie.

The LP’s candidate said the other candidates were not formidable and not with the people, adding that he was ready to change the narrative at the senatorial district.

The Edo Central seat became vacant following election of Senator Monday Okpebholo as governor.

Okojie, who spoke shortly after he emerged as candidate of the party, said he expected to be victorious at the poll.

The LP’s candidate further expressed confidence that he would defeat the candidates of both the APC and that of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P).

His words, “I am expecting victory at the polls. We will go to the grassroots and talk to them. The people will decide who will be the next Senator in Edo Central.

“My first item as a Senator is to change the narrative in Edo Central. There has been no voice. We have had people represent us at the Senate and they have been practically speechless. We need someone who should be able to stand up and speak for the people of Edo Central because we are known for standing up to make our demands.

“For some years now, you really hear a voice from Edo Central speaking in the Senate. There is no federal presence there and somebody needs to take that responsibility and I feel I am the one who has the capacity to do that.

“I do not see the APC or PDP as formidable. The only thing we know is that the best candidate should be the one to go. I am serious about defeating them. I have my people and they are with me. As far as my people are with me, I am not rattled. I don’t have any godfather but I have the people backing me.”
